Dr. Jack Penner shares his journey from sports medicine to founding Kuros, a longevity-focused medical practice that embodies the Medicine 3.0 philosophy of proactive, personalized preventative care.• Former UCSF faculty member now running Kuros, offering telemedicine services in New York and California• Grew up with dual influences: passionate about sports performance and son of a primary care physician• Defines Medicine 3.0 as proactive, personalized care focused on preventing chronic diseases of aging• Sets aggressive health benchmarks much earlier than traditional medicine - catching problems before they fully develop• Uses advanced diagnostic tools like continuous glucose monitors, ApoB testing, and specialized imaging not readily available in conventional care• Provides high-touch care by reviewing patients' meal photos, exercise routines, and making specific lifestyle recommendations• Focuses on helping patients "age into" the life they want with both physical optimization and mental/emotional wellbeing• Takes a whole-system approach rather than optimizing individual biomarkers in isolationConnect with Dr. Penner at kurosmedical.com or subscribe to his Substack "The Kuros Corner" for ongoing insights about longevity medicine.Ready to revolutionize your longevity clinic's approach?
